You can fly to Savanah, Georgia or Jacksonville, Florida, however the JAX Airport is a bit closer to Jekyll.
There are rental homes/condos/apartments/hotel rooms to fit any budget. We highly suggest finding a rental space on the island rather than a hotel room, as you don't have use of a kitchen in a hotel. There are limited food options on the Island, so a kitchen can come in handy. The island is fairly small as well, so as long as you're on it, no one will be too far away from one another.
Yes and no. Yes because there are little to no car shares/taxis in the area. You will need a car to get to and from the airport. Once on the island, however, it's pretty easy to get around. Jekyll is very walker/biker friendly with paths to get you anywhere you'd want to go. Bikes are easily rented, as are golf carts, so take your pick and save on gas!
